Blue-winged Teal In Great Basin
Blue-winged Teal in Great Basin has fallen sharply: down 59% on the route-weighted index since 1972.

Forecast
If the recent trend holds, Blue-winged Teal in Great Basin is projected to fall about 75% by 2029 — from 0.08 in 2024 to a central estimate of 0.02 (95% range 0.00–0.42).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±176.2%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
